Are Dermalogica products tested on animals?

Dermalogica is committed to delivering effective skincare solutions while adhering to ethical practices. The company does not engage in animal testing and has made a clear stance against it. Their products are designed using advanced scientific research and development methods that do not rely on animal testing. Instead, Dermalogica focuses on alternative testing methods that ensure safety and efficacy without involving animals. Additionally, Dermalogica actively supports cruelty-free initiatives and is recognized by various organizations that advocate for the humane treatment of animals. This commitment to cruelty-free practices reflects their dedication to not only skin health but also the ethical aspects of product development. It is always a good idea to refer to the specific product packaging or the Dermalogica website for the most current information regarding their testing policies, as policies can evolve over time. Overall, consumers can feel confident that Dermalogica prioritizes ethical considerations alongside delivering high-quality skincare products.
